How they compare

Faroe Islands currently reports 11.35 billion current LCU against 10.97 billion current LCU in Solomon Islands, a difference of 376.80 million current LCU.

Across all 22 years both countries report, Faroe Islands has been ahead every year.

Faroe Islands ranks 161st and Solomon Islands ranks 162nd of 190 countries.

Faroe Islands has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

This field includes expenditure on goods and services by the Household and NPISH sector for the direct satisfaction of human needs or wants, whether individual or collective.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This series is expressed in local currency units.
